Can You Put Baby Milk Back in the Fridge After Warming?
When it comes to the delicate process of feeding infants, especially with breast milk, parents often find themselves navigating a maze of guidelines and recommendations. One common question that arises is whether warmed breast milk can be safely returned to the refrigerator for later use. The answer is nuanced and hinges on several important factors.
Understanding the Risks
The primary concern with putting warmed breast milk back in the fridge is the potential for bacterial contamination. Once breast milk is warmed, it can become a breeding ground for bacteria, particularly if it has been in contact with the baby’s mouth during feeding. According to experts, once milk has been warmed and not fully consumed, it should ideally be discarded rather than refrigerated again. This is because bacteria introduced from the baby’s mouth can multiply, and simply refrigerating the milk does not eliminate these risks.
Guidelines for Safe Storage
However, there are some guidelines that can help parents make informed decisions. If the warmed milk has not been fed to the baby and has been kept at room temperature for less than two hours, it can be safely returned to the fridge. The Centers for Disease Control and Prevention (CDC) emphasizes that breast milk can be stored in the refrigerator if it will not be used within a few hours.
Moreover, if the milk was warmed but not used, and it has been kept in a clean container, it may be acceptable to refrigerate it again, provided it is done within a reasonable timeframe. The general rule of thumb is that warmed milk should be used or discarded within two hours to minimize the risk of bacterial growth.

Can you put baby milk back in fridge after warming?
Once a bottle is prepared or taken from the fridge for feeding, use the formula within 1 hour or throw it out. You cannot re-refrigerate formula once it has been warmed or reaches room temperature. The reason experts recommend you throw away unused formula is because bacteria can begin to grow.

How long can baby formula sit out after being warmed?
How Long Can a Bottle Keep at Room Temperature? Throw out any prepared or ready-to-feed formula that’s been sitting out for 2 hours or more, or within 1 hour from start of feeding.
Can warmed milk be refrigerated again?
Healthcare professionals, including lactation consultants and pediatricians, generally recommend against refrigerating breast milk again once it has been warmed. This is because once breast milk is warmed to a typical feeding temperature, bacterial growth will accelerate.
Can breast milk be warmed up twice?
Breast milk that has been refrigerated or frozen can only be heated once. Never reheat breast milk as this accumulates bacteria the more it is exposed to warmer temperatures. Breast milk that has been heated or brought to room temperature needs to be consumed within 2 hours.

Can I put milk back in the fridge after thawing?
Frozen milk should always be thawed in the refrigerator, not at room temperature, because as soon as it’s warmed above 40 degrees, bacteria can start growing. Even if you put it back in the refrigerator after, it would just slow down the growth of new bacteria, but not kill any bacteria that may already be present.
